What is AfriTin Mining?

AfriTin Mining
Minerals & Mining

AfriTin Mining operates as a specialized resource extraction firm with a primary focus on near-production tin assets. Its flagship Uis Project in Namibia serves as the cornerstone of its portfolio, complemented by the Mokopane Tin asset in South Africa. The company is strategically positioned to capitalize on the increasing industrial demand for tin, which is essential for electronics, soldering, and emerging green technologies. By focusing on high-potential, near-production sites, AfriTin Mining minimizes exploration risk while maximizing the potential for rapid revenue generation and operational scale.

How much funding has AfriTin Mining raised?

AfriTin Mining has raised a total of $52.2M across 4 funding rounds:

Share Placement (2020): $3.9M, investors not publicly disclosed

Debt (2022): $5.8M led by Development Bank of Namibia

Share Placement (2022): $17.5M, investors not publicly disclosed

Private Equity (2022): $25M featuring Orion Resource Partners
